How to post a photo?
First, your photo must be stored on the internet and has a URL, or web address (ie. http://www.mypicture.com/mypicture.jpg)

If your photo is not stored on the internet, you can set up an account in one of the free photo gallery website. We recommend www.photobucket.com or www.flickr.com.

If you are a FWR subscriber (see below) already, you can set up an album in our photo gallery (what is this? (http://www.fishingwithrod.com/member/gallery/members)) and upload the photos onto it. Please email me at info@fishingwithrod.com to set up the album.

Once your photos are on the internet, you have to obtain the web address of the photo that yo wish to post. Simply put your mouse on top of the photo, right click, select Properties. Highlight the Address (URL) and copy it (right click, select copy).

In the field where you want to post your message, add in the following code.

Code: [Select]
[img] [/img]
or click on the (http://www.fishingwithrod.com/yabbse/Themes/default/images/bbc/img.gif) once and the code will show up.

Insert the web address/URL of your photo in between the two codes by paste.

It should now look something like:

Code: [Select]
[img]http://www.mypicture.com/mypicture.jpg[/img]
